Event handling for real-time simulation with hybrid systems
Recently, due to the complexity and its increase of the product specifications in automotive industry, the Model — Based — Development (MBD) is introduced to make the development more efficient. Especially, in the control design, Hardware — In — the — Loop — Simulation (HILS) which is automatic testing system for ECU is applied to decrease the verification and validation time because it is increased by the complexity of the controller.
